Audit item 14: Gatecount turnstile counter, north stand. Verify daily totals reconcile against scanner logs within 0.5%. Check battery backup fired during last outage drill. Confirm counter resets at 04:00 local and that resets are logged. Flag any drift over three consecutive match days. New auditors: don't trust the display panel, pull raw counts. Escalations on this item go to the person named below.

named custodian: Brivan Eliath Quenox Frador

CI note: the StageGrid seat-map renderer for the Orpheline Theatre began failing visual-diff checks after the SVG sanitizer was upgraded. Root cause is a stricter attribute allowlist stripping row labels; no injection path was found. Fix is pinned in the render-safe branch and passes all sandbox checks. The failing pipeline can be audited under the trace below.

pipeline stamp: htk31_f769b577b3028a4e9958e5bb8d1259a

Quarterly Planning Note — Vantrel Product Line Pricing

For the incoming director: current Vantrel pricing dates from the original launch and no longer reflects support costs. We propose moving the base tier up 6% and folding the starter tier into it, effective next quarter. Margin impact is modest; churn modelling by Arno Kesh suggests under 2% attrition. Regional teams have been consulted and distributor notice drafts are ready. Approval is needed by the planning deadline. The confidential rationale and forward plan appear immediately below.

confidential, kagup-bafog: Fraaxax Group is in early talks to buy Soroxox Group for about $343.8 million. The Olidor launch date is June 14, and nothing goes to the press before then. Legal wants the Aldmirek Logistics term sheet signed before July 23.

// Config hot-reloading for the Brindlemere client.
// The watcher polls /etc/brindlemere/client.toml every 15s and applies
// changes without a restart. Connection pool size, retry budgets, and
// timeout values are all reloadable; endpoint URLs are not, by design,
// since swapping hosts mid-flight corrupted the session cache in the
// 3.2 release. Reload events are logged at INFO so the release manager
// can confirm rollout without shelling in. The client authenticates to
// the internal Fennic registry with the key that follows.

app token of tageg-kadug = vxb2-26